Suzuki GSX-R250 (1987)

The Suzuki GSX-R250 was a motorcycle produced in 1987. It had a four-stroke, transverse four-cylinder, DOHC engine with 4 valves per cylinder and a capacity of 248cc with a bore x stroke of 49 x 33 mm. It had a high compression ratio of 12.5:1 and a liquid cooling system, and was lubricated with a wet sump. It had single carburetor induction and transistor ignition, with an electric starting system. The maximum power output was 33.6 kW/45 hp at 14000 rpm, and a maximum torque of 24 Nm/2.5 kgf-m/17.7 lb-ft at 10500 rpm. The clutch system was wet, multi-plate, and cable operated, and the transmission had six-speeds with a final drive chain. The frame was made with steel twin spars, with telescopic forks for the front suspension and full floater for the rear suspension. The front brakes had 2x300mm discs, two-piston calipers, while the rear had a single 240mm disc with one piston caliper. The front wheel was a 2.50-17 and the rear was a 3.50-17, with tyre sizes of 110/80-R17 and 130/70-R17 respectively. The rake was 26o with a trail of 103mm/4.1in, and it had a length of 2000mm/78.7in, a width of 700mm/27.6in and a height of 1105mm/43.5in. The wheelbase was 1370mm/53.9in, ground clearance of 125mm/4.9in and seat height of 770mm/30.3in. It had a dry weight of 138 kg/304 lbs and a fuel capacity of 16 litres/4.2 US gal/3.5 Imp gal. Its top speed was 180 km/h/112 mph.
